KINGS of MACEDON. Alexander III ‘the Great’. 336-323 BC. AR Drachm (15mm, 4.18 g, 12h). Lampsakos mint. Struck under Kalas or Demarchos, circa 328/5-323 BC. Head of Herakles right, wearing lion skin / Zeus Aëtophoros seated left; club in left field, M below throne. Price 1347 var. (no letter below throne); Hersh, Additions 12 = BM inv. 2002,0101.257 (same dies); ADM II Series II, 7 var. (same; same obv. die). Toned, remnants of find patina, light cleaning scratches. VF. Very rare, only three in CoinArchives.
